Abstract
Let W be a contraction on the complete metric space (E,d) with contractivity factor s and fixed point f. Let g be in E. Then d(f,g) ≤ (1/(1 - s)) d(g, W(g)). Thus, by minimizing the distance between g and W(g) (the collage of the image), we hope to minimize the distance between the fixed point f and the given image g. Of course, if the value of s is close to 1, nothing ensures that this method provides a good approximation. In this work we present a new approach of construction of the operator W that guarantees a better fidelity due to the better bound we put on d( f,g), without any cost on compression.
